Living with Hydranencephaly


Hydranencephaly is a rare neurological condition characterized by the absence or severe underdevelopment of the cerebral hemispheres, the part of the brain responsible for higher cognitive functions. While living with Hydranencephaly can present unique challenges, it is possible to lead a fulfilling life with appropriate support and care.



Medical Management


Individuals with Hydranencephaly require comprehensive medical management to address their specific needs. It is crucial to work closely with a team of healthcare professionals, including neurologists, pediatricians, therapists, and specialists, to develop a personalized care plan.


Regular medical check-ups are essential to monitor overall health, growth, and development. These visits allow healthcare providers to assess any potential complications or changes in symptoms.


Medication management may be necessary to control seizures, manage pain, or address other associated medical conditions. It is important to strictly follow the prescribed medication regimen and communicate any concerns or side effects to the healthcare team.



Supportive Therapies


Therapies play a crucial role in maximizing the potential and quality of life for individuals with Hydranencephaly. These therapies are tailored to address specific challenges and may include:



  • Physical therapy: Physical therapists can help improve mobility, muscle strength, and coordination through exercises and specialized techniques.

  • Occupational therapy: Occupational therapists focus on enhancing daily living skills, fine motor skills, and independence in activities of daily life.

  • Speech therapy: Speech-language pathologists assist in improving communication skills, swallowing abilities, and overall oral motor function.

  • Early intervention: Early intervention programs provide specialized services to infants and young children to promote development and address specific needs.



Assistive Devices and Adaptive Equipment


Assistive devices and adaptive equipment can greatly enhance independence and improve the overall quality of life for individuals with Hydranencephaly. These may include:



  • Mobility aids: Wheelchairs, walkers, or orthotic devices can assist with mobility and provide support.

  • Communication aids: Augmentative and alternative communication (AAC) devices, such as speech-generating devices or sign language, can help individuals communicate effectively.

  • Assistive technology: Various technological tools, such as specialized computer software or environmental control systems, can enable greater independence and accessibility.



Emotional and Social Support


Living with Hydranencephaly can have emotional and social implications for both individuals and their families. It is important to seek and maintain a strong support network:



  • Family and friends: Surrounding yourself with understanding and supportive loved ones can provide emotional support and practical assistance.

  • Support groups: Connecting with other individuals and families facing similar challenges can offer a sense of belonging, shared experiences, and valuable advice.

  • Counseling: Professional counseling or therapy can help individuals and families navigate the emotional impact of Hydranencephaly and develop coping strategies.



Education and Advocacy


Education and advocacy are essential components of living with Hydranencephaly:



  • Education: It is important to educate yourself, family members, and caregivers about Hydranencephaly to better understand the condition, its challenges, and available resources.

  • Advocacy: Advocating for your rights and needs, as well as raising awareness about Hydranencephaly, can help improve access to appropriate healthcare, support services, and inclusion in the community.



Enjoying Life


While living with Hydranencephaly may present unique challenges, it is important to focus on enjoying life and promoting overall well-being:



  • Engage in activities: Participate in activities that bring joy and stimulate cognitive, physical, and emotional well-being.

  • Celebrate achievements: Recognize and celebrate milestones, no matter how small, as they represent progress and personal growth.

  • Take care of yourself: Prioritize self-care, seek respite when needed, and maintain a healthy balance between caregiving responsibilities and personal well-being.



Remember, each individual with Hydranencephaly is unique, and their needs may vary. It is important to work closely with healthcare professionals, adapt strategies as necessary, and provide a nurturing and supportive environment to ensure the best possible quality of life.
